Marjorie has written about pretty much everything in her inspirational and tender autobiography. The memories range from her childhood years during World War II; her struggle against and triumph over agoraphobia, anxiety and panic attacks; family life over the course of many decades, including 2 marriages and six children; to becoming a well-known distinguished Medium in Spiritualist Churches of Yorkshire and Lincolnshire. Despite such a varied and demanding life, Marjorie's perseverance and tenderness is evident throughout this absorbing memoir. (Part review by Manager of Waterstone's)
This compelling autobiography abounds with intimate details of familiar Hull locations, local organisations and members of her large extended family.
With complete openness and honesty, she takes us on her personal journey. I was impressed with the fortitude with which she overcame so many stressful periods in her life, yet always facing the future with excitement. (John Weller Hull Daily Mail)
